The Environmental Impact: Balancing Thrills with Sustainability

Amusement parks are swiftly recognizing their environmental responsibilities amidst growing ecological concerns. Advanced water recycling systems, energy-efficient lighting, and solar-powered operations are becoming industry norms at leading venues. This sustainable approach appeases eco-conscious visitors and reduces operational costs over time. Yet, the path to true ecological sustainability is multifaceted, facing hurdles from every angle.

Ride materials, waste management, and park expansions still challenge environmental sanctity. Innovative solutions often grapple with higher costs, even as guest demand forces change. Many parks are experimenting with renewable energy sources, aiming for carbon neutrality within ambitious timelines. However, retrofitting existing infrastructure for greener operations remains costly and complex, leaving stakeholders weighing costs against long-term benefits. As governmental pressures tighten, achieving sustainability is imperative.

Guest awareness initiatives merge engagement with education. By integrating conservation messages within attractions and educational experiences, parks cultivate environmental stewardship among visitors. This approach connects planetary well-being with personal enjoyment, inspiring behavior change. Such efforts symbolize a potential future where entertainment and environmentalism coexist harmoniously, benefiting all. Emerging green technology offers hope in this balancing act, although its adoption varies across the industry. Innovations like energy storage advancements and environmental monitoring systems could soon redefine operations entirely. Real-time data guides proactive decision-making, optimizing ride cycles during off-peak hours to conserve power. Although promising, scaling these solutions remains an expensive proposition, tempered by their potential for widespread impact.
